Description

Description

The present volume is a synthetic and modular study regarding the critical relationship between democracy and foreign policy.

With a reflective background drawn from International Relations theory concerning hegemony and leadership styles in the exercise of political power and foreign policy, as delineated by the renowned operational code of Alexander George, and using empirical-analytical guidance through a thorough investigation of four distinct case studies — specifically the Attic orator and politician Demosthenes, Eleftherios Venizelos, John F. Kennedy, and Konstantinos Karamanlis — we attempt to delineate the fundamental philosophical, historical, institutional, political, and international characteristics of foreign policy within the framework of a democratic regime.

[Excerpt from the text on the back cover of the edition]
